Fire burns warn against kerosene stove use

Ethel Yates suffered severe facial burns when coal oil and live coals ignited after a match was used to start a fire in a stove at the Hzra Wood home last Thursday. Doctors say no permanent scar is likely. The incident underscores danger of kerosene with live coals in stoves.

Pension bill speech argues for higher veteran T pensions

Congressman Barhant urges a dollar daily increase for all old soldiers noting rising living costs and greater disabilities since past pension levels. Marriage of Miss Bessie V. Christner to Fred M. Stoner

Miss Bessie V. Christner daughter of Mrs J W Walburn of this place married Fred M Stoner of Warsaw in a ceremony conducted by Rev F A Ainsworth of Warsaw. The vows were exchanged Saturday evening March 26 in Warsaw with only immediate relatives present.

New Five Cent Piece Delayed Coin Release

Government authorized new five cent coins bearing George Washington. Public awaited after Lincoln cent novelty wore off. Planned release by February 22 Washington birthday miscarried.

Obituary for Sarah Leckron Denney of Indiana

Sarah Leckron Denney born September 8 1861 in Licking County Ohio died March 26 1910 aged 49 6 18 married Francis Alvin Denny September 18 1886 five children two daughters and three sons survived by husband two daughters Mrs Dotta Miller and Mrs James Fisher two sons Burr and Frank two grandchildren three brothers and three sisters funeral Monday at ten o clock brick church five miles east Rev Wright officiated.

Summeros Hardware Opening Sets Record Sales at Silver Lake

Summeros first annual hardware opening ends Saturday evening with record sales of buggies, farm implements and machinery. Weather kept many away until the final day, but Saturday brings excellent turnout and 35 buggies sold along with plows cultivators and hay machinery. Gifts were distributed to several attendees including John G. Smith Harmon Hire Oliver Plow Ulyssess Personett Al Carr Allen Blue and Frank Getty.

Fish Commissioners Fire On Fishmen At Beaver Dam Lake

Two fish commissioners on Beaver Dam lake near Warsaw were fired upon by violators while arresting netting fishers on Thursday night. The officers escaped unharmed, found the suspects’ horse and buggy, a quantity of fish and a net, and took the entire outfit to Warsaw.

Move on orders issued by Wabash police for crowd control

For the first time in Wabash history the police issued move on orders. Chief directed officers to clear street corners in downtown as crowds gathered to discuss religion politics craps comets and shingles. Corner cops repeatedly urged loiterers to move as pleasant weather drew pedestrians and women to the streets.

Huntington Ends Sunday Funerals Except for Health Cases

No Sunday funerals will be held in Huntington except for deaths from contagious diseases or other urgent causes requiring immediate burial for health protection.

Hog brings 61 dollar price in Akron area sale

E Richter near Akron recently sold a large hog for 61 dollars described as strong as a horse of the era and worth more than two good cows or three hundred bushels of corn in the same period.

Mrs Maggie Gerkin Beloved matriarch dies in Indiana

Mrs Maggie Jon es Gerkin born near Bucyrus Ohio died in LaGrange Indiana aged 71 years 9 months after long illness converted in girlhood united with Angola Indiana church survived by two sons and other relatives funeral held at home then laid to rest in Lak Cemetery conducted by Rev Hoffmeir
